#129577 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#129577 is composed of 7.1% red, 58.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 166.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 32.7%. #129577 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ffee with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#129577 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#129577 has RGB values of R:18, G:149,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1217911.

Shades and Tints of #129577
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010907 is the darkest color, while #f6f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#129577
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525554 is the less saturated color, while #05a27e is the most saturated one.
